About
Timothy Finnigan is an Adjunct Instructor of Marketing at the Quinlan School of Business, Loyola University Chicago, where he has taught digital marketing and marketing management courses since 2014. He integrates real-world industry experience into his academic role, shaping future marketing professionals.
Education:
- MBA in Marketing, Loyola University Chicago
- Bachelor's Degree in Marketing, University of Dayton
His research and teaching interests center on digital marketing, marketing analytics, and strategic marketing leadership. With a strong focus on practical application, Finnigan emphasizes data-driven decision-making and customer engagement strategies in modern marketing environments.
While no formal publications or research projects are listed, his professional experience informs a practice-based approach to marketing education. His industry insights are regularly shared through The Marketing Rapport Podcast, where he interviews marketing leaders on emerging trends and best practices.
